The melody begins slowly, the low dark sound of the lone cello filling the empty space and echoing around much like the thoughts in her own mind. The melancholic music seems to come from the shadows of the large room, its darkness broken only by small streaks of sunlight and her stark white dress. The extended notes from the cello continue, irreverent to her inner turmoil, yet deeply attuned to its anguish. She takes a deep breath, making the small beads on the bodice twinkle, slowly lifts her delicate chin, and raises her arms to position. ...

I never even know their names. I watch their faces melt from their skulls, I hear their screams and I smell their burnt flesh, but I never know their names.I remember Number 1. I was 13 and happily walking out of the mall after a fun day of shopping and laughing with my friends. I remember the heat of the humid summer afternoon struggling into our lungs after hours of artificial air-conditioned oxygen. I had fallen behind my peers to answer my father’s text. He was always worried like that and I never knew why until that exact day.I remember...
